#!/usr/bin/env bash
### Created by Peter Forret ( pforret ) on 2021-07-07
### Based on https://github.com/pforret/bashew 1.16.5
script_version="0.0.1" # if there is a VERSION.md in this script's folder, it will take priority for version number
readonly script_author="peter@forret.com"
readonly script_created="2021-07-07"
readonly run_as_root=-1 # run_as_root: 0 = don't check anything / 1 = script MUST run as root / -1 = script MAY NOT run as root
list_options() {
echo -n "
#commented lines will be filtered
flag|h|help|show usage
flag|q|quiet|no output
flag|v|verbose|output more
flag|f|force|do not ask for confirmation (always yes)
flag|f|force|do not ask for confirmation (always yes)
flag|Q|qrcode|add QR encode of URL to image
option|l|log_dir|folder for log files |$HOME/log/$script_prefix
option|o|out_dir|output folder for the m4a/mp3 files (default: derive from URL)|
option|t|tmp_dir|folder for temp files|.tmp
option|A|AUDIO|audio format to use|m4a
option|C|COMMENT|comment metadata for audio file|%c %a
option|D|DAYS|maximum days to go back|365
option|F|FONT|font to use for subtitle|Helvetica
option|G|FONTSIZE|font size|32
option|I|FILTER|only download matching mixes|/
option|N|NUMBER|maximum downloads from this playlist|10
option|P|PIXELS|resolution image (width/height in pixels)|500
option|S|SUBTITLE|subtitle for the image|%u @ %y
option|T|TITLE|title metadata for audio file|%d: %t (%mmin)
param|1|action|action to perform: download/update/check
param|?|url|Mixcloud URL of a user or a playlist
" | grep -v '^#' | grep -v '^\s*$'
}
#####################################################################
## Put your main script here
#####################################################################
main() {
log_to_file "[$script_basename] $script_version started"
# shellcheck disable=SC2154
action=$(lower_case "$action")
case $action in
download)
#TIP: use «$script_prefix download URL» to download all audio files
#TIP:> $script_prefix download https://www.mixcloud.com/DjBlasto/playlists/discosauro/
# shellcheck disable=SC2154
do_download "$url"
;;
check|env)
## leave this default action, it will make it easier to test your script
#TIP: use «$script_prefix check» to check if this script is ready to execute and what values the options/flags are
#TIP:> $script_prefix check
#TIP: use «$script_prefix env» to generate an example .env file
#TIP:> $script_prefix env > .env
check_script_settings
yt-dlp -U || echo "Run 'pip install --upgrade yt-dlp' to update yt-dlp"
;;
install)
#TIP: use «$script_prefix install» to install all required binaries
#TIP:> $script_prefix install
install_required_binaries
;;
update)
## leave this default action, it will make it easier to test your script
#TIP: use «$script_prefix update» to update to the latest version
#TIP:> $script_prefix check
update_script_to_latest
;;
*)
die "action [$action] not recognized"
;;
esac
log_to_file "[$script_basename] ended after $SECONDS secs"
#TIP: >>> bash script created with «pforret/bashew»
#TIP: >>> for bash development, also check out «pforret/setver» and «pforret/progressbar»
}
#####################################################################
## Put your helper scripts here
#####################################################################
function do_download(){
log_to_file "download from mixcloud [$1]"
require_binary AtomicParsley atomicparsley
require_binary curl
require_binary jq
require_binary mogrify imagemagick
require_binary python3
require_binary yt-dlp "pip install --upgrade yt-dlp"
announce "Download $NUMBER mixes from $1"
local username uniq playlist not_before
local input_url="$1"
username=$(echo "$1" | cut -d/ -f4)
playlist=$(basename "$1")
uniq=$(echo "$1" | hash 8)
[[ "$playlist" == "uploads" ]] && playlist=$username
# shellcheck disable=SC2154
local temp_json="$tmp_dir/$username.$uniq.$DAYS.json"
debug "JSON cache: $temp_json"
if [[ -f "$temp_json" ]] ; then
# delete $temp_json if size is 0 bytes
[[ ! -s "$temp_json" ]] && rm "$temp_json"
# delete if it is too old
# find "$tmp_dir" -mtime "+$DAYS" -name "$username.*.json" -delete
fi
if [[ ! -f "$temp_json" ]] ; then
# shellcheck disable=SC2154
not_before=$(calculate_not_before "$DAYS")
debug "$os_kernel => only consider mixes after $not_before"
debug "[$temp_json]: download JSON from $1"
"yt-dlp" -j --dateafter "$not_before" "$1" > "$temp_json"
fi
debug "[$temp_json]: $(du -h "$temp_json" | awk '{print $1}')"
# shellcheck disable=SC2154
local download_log="$log_dir/download.$uniq.log"
local mix_url mix_id mix_title mix_duration mix_date mix_file mix_uploader mix_thumb mix_count mix_artist mix_description mix_uniq mix_minutes
mix_count=0
# shellcheck disable=SC2154
# shellcheck disable=SC2034
jq -r '[.webpage_url, .id, .title , .duration, .upload_date, ._filename, .uploader_id, .thumbnail, .artist ] | join("\t")' "$temp_json" \
| grep -i "$FILTER" \
| while IFS=$'\t' read -r mix_url mix_id mix_title mix_duration mix_date mix_file mix_uploader mix_thumb mix_artist; do
mix_count=$((mix_count + 1))
[[ $mix_count -gt $NUMBER ]] && continue
mix_uniq=$(echo "$mix_url" | hash 4)
mix_minutes=$(( (mix_duration+30) / 60))
mix_description="$( jq -r "select(.id==\"$mix_id\") | .description" "$temp_json" | tr "\r\n\t" " " | sed 's/null//')"
debug "> Mix: $mix_count: $mix_file"
local pretty_date="${mix_date:0:4}-${mix_date:4:2}-${mix_date:6:2}"
# shellcheck disable=SC2154
[[ -z "$out_dir" ]] && out_dir="output/$username"
[[ ! -d "$out_dir" ]] && mkdir -p "$out_dir"
local mix_output="$out_dir/$mix_date.${mix_id:0:20}.$mix_uniq.$AUDIO"
local mix_image="$tmp_dir/$mix_date.${mix_id:0:20}.$mix_uniq.jpg"
local mix_temp
if [[ ! -f "$mix_output" ]] ; then
mix_temp="$tmp_dir/$(basename "$mix_output")"
debug "> Download: $mix_temp -> $mix_output ..."
"yt-dlp" --no-overwrites --no-progress --extract-audio --audio-format "$AUDIO" -o "$mix_temp" "$mix_url" >> "$download_log"
mv "$mix_temp" "$mix_output"
fi
curl -s -o "$mix_image" "$mix_thumb"
[[ ! -f "$mix_image" ]] && cp "$script_install_folder/assets/mixcloud.jpg" "$mix_image"
debug "> Resize & noise: $mix_image"
local image_dimensions="${PIXELS}x${PIXELS}"
mogrify -resize "$image_dimensions" -brightness-contrast -30x10 -statistic median 3x3 -attenuate .5 +noise Gaussian "$mix_image"
if [[ "$qrcode" -gt 0 ]] ; then
require_binary "qrencode"
local qr_orig="$tmp_dir/qr.$uniq.jpg"
debug "> QR Code: $qr_orig"
qrencode -o "$qr_orig" -m 2 -s 25 "$input_url"
mogrify -resize "300x300" "$qr_orig"
convert "$mix_image" "$qr_orig" -gravity Center -compose dissolve -define compose:args=50,100 -composite "$mix_image.temp.png"
mv "$mix_image.temp.png" "$mix_image"
# rm "$qr_orig"
fi
local new_sub
if [[ -n "$SUBTITLE" ]] ; then
new_sub=$(build_title "$SUBTITLE" "$mix_id" "$pretty_date" "$mix_title" "$mix_artist" "$mix_description" "$mix_minutes" "$username")
debug "> Subtitle: '$new_sub'"
mogrify -gravity south -pointsize "$FONTSIZE" -font "$FONT" -undercolor "#0008" -fill "#FFF" -annotate '0x0+0+5' "$new_sub" "$mix_image"
fi
local mix_comment
mix_comment="$(build_title "$COMMENT" "$mix_id" "$pretty_date" "$mix_title" "$mix_artist" "$mix_description" "$mix_minutes" "$username")"
mix_title="$(build_title "$TITLE" "$mix_id" "$pretty_date" "$mix_title" "$mix_artist" "$mix_description" "$mix_minutes" "$username")"
debug "Audio title : '$mix_title'"
debug "Audio comment : '$mix_comment'"
if [[ -f "$mix_image" ]] ; then
debug "Annotate: $mix_output"
AtomicParsley "$mix_output" \
--overWrite \
--artist "$username" \
--album "$playlist" \
--title "$mix_title" \
--podcastURL "$mix_url" \
--artwork "$mix_image" \
--category "mixcloud" \
--keyword "shmixcloud" \
--description "$mix_comment" \
--comment "$mix_comment" \
&>> "$download_log"
else
debug "Add metadata on $mix_output"
AtomicParsley "$mix_output" \
--overWrite \
--artist "$username" \
--album "$playlist" \
--title "$mix_title" \
--podcastURL "$mix_url" \
--category "mixcloud" \
--keyword "shmixcloud" \
--description "$mix_comment" \
--comment "$mix_comment" \
&>> "$download_log"
fi
[[ "$verbose" -eq 0 ]] && rm "$mix_image"
out "$mix_output"
log_to_file "[$mix_output] downloaded and enriched"
done
}
function build_title(){
# pattern="$1"
# mix_url mix_id mix_title mix_duration mix_date mix_file mix_uploader mix_thumb mix_artist mix_description
echo "$1" \
| awk \
-v id="$2" \
-v date="$3" \
-v title="$4" \
-v artist="$5" \
-v description="$6" \
-v minutes="$7" \
-v user="$8" \
'{
year=substr(date,1,4);
gsub(/%a/,artist);
gsub(/%c/,description);
gsub(/%d/,date);
gsub(/%i/,id);
gsub(/%m/,minutes);
gsub(/%t/,title);
gsub(/%u/,user);
gsub(/%y/,year);
print;
}' \
| cut -c1-256
}
function remove_duplicate_words(){
awk '{
split($0,arr," ");
c=0;
for (v in arr) c++;
for (m=c;m >= 1;m--)
for (n=1; n<m;n++)
if (arr[m] == arr[n])
delete arr[m];
str="";
for (k=1;k<=c;k++)
{
if (arr[k] != "")
str=str""arr[k]" "
}
print substr(str,1,length(str)-1)
}'
}
function calculate_not_before(){
local DAYS="$1"
if [[ $os_kernel == "Darwin" ]] ; then
# /bin/date works differently for MacOS
date -v "-${DAYS}d" '+%Y%m%d'
else
date -d "$DAYS days ago" '+%Y%m%d'
fi
}
